Abstract

Research at the intersection of digital technologies and business model innovation (BMI) has expanded rapidly since the mid-2010s, yet its intellectual architecture—the conceptual foundations, influential scholars, citation anchors, and thematic clusters that give it coherence—remains poorly charted. Narrative and systematic reviews have proven insufficient to map a field now generating more than 260 peer-reviewed publications per year across at least twenty-seven disciplinary categories. This paper addresses that gap by conducting a comprehensive bibliometric analysis of 1,707 Scopus-indexed journal articles published between 2004 and early 2026. Drawing on publication trend analysis, author and institutional productivity mapping, citation and co-citation analysis, and keyword co-occurrence examination—all executed through the Biblioshiny interface of R Studio—we delineate four distinct developmental epochs that trace the field's evolution from pre-paradigmatic exploration to consolidation. Citation analysis identifies a compact set of foundational texts, anchored by Verhoef et al. (2021), Chesbrough (2010), and Ghobakhloo (2020), that continue to organise scholarly discourse across sub-fields. Keyword analysis reveals business model innovation, digital transformation, artificial intelligence, and sustainability as the field's dominant conceptual pillars, while also exposing theoretical fault lines at the boundaries of these clusters. The findings offer an empirically grounded road map for future research and establish a replicable methodological benchmark for ongoing monitoring of this rapidly evolving domain.

Mapping the Intellectual Structure and Evolution of Innovation Survey Research: A Comparative Bibliometric Analysis of European and Non-European Perspectives

Innovation Survey Research (ISR) has developed over three decades since the launch of the Community Innovation Survey (CIS) in 1992, yet no prior study has systematically mapped its intellectual structure, developmental trajectories, or regional differences. This study addresses three research questions: (1) the knowledge growth, impact and collaborative relationships of ISR; (2) the trajectories of evolution and transformation of its core research themes; and (3) the differences between European and non-European ISR. We conducted a comparative bibliometric analysis of 1,012 Scopus-indexed articles published between 1995 and 2024, combining co-occurrence network mapping, Leiden clustering and thematic literature review of representative works within each cluster. ISR has shown sustained growth since 2008 and a sharp increase in citations after 2020, reaching 54,451 total citations. Six thematic clusters were identified: firm innovation activities, open innovation and absorptive capacity, innovation types, manufacturing and service innovation, eco-innovation and innovation ambidexterity. These clusters have evolved from industry-centred RnD towards more specialised innovation typologies. After excluding 17 theoretical or multi-region articles, comparative analysis between European ([Formula: see text]) and non-European ([Formula: see text]) ISR reveals different trajectories. European ISR shows higher journal concentration and five clusters centred on complex topics such as open innovation and innovation ambidexterity, while non-European ISR displays a more dispersed structure with three clusters emphasising fundamental innovation activities, innovation barriers and developing-economy contexts. This study offers the first comprehensive knowledge map of ISR, contributing to understanding its intellectual evolution and regional characteristics, with implications for innovation policy, data infrastructure and international research collaboration.

MAPPING THE INTELLECTUAL STRUCTURE OF OPEN INNOVATION IN SMEs: A BIBLIOMETRIC ANALYSIS (2009–2025)

This study provides a bibliometric analysis of research on open innovation in small and medium-sized enterprises (SMEs) over the period 2009–2025. Using a dataset of 500 journal articles indexed in the Web of Science, the study maps the field’s intellectual structure, publication trends, influential sources, leading authors, country productivity, collaboration patterns, and thematic evolution. The results show a steady growth in scientific production, particularly after 2017, indicating the increasing consolidation of open innovation in SMEs as a distinct research domain. The literature concentrates on a limited number of influential journals, especially Technovation and Technological Forecasting and Social Change, while a small group of highly cited publications forms the conceptual foundation of the field. Thematic analysis reveals that the field is primarily structured around open innovation, SMEs, performance, research and development, absorptive capacity, and knowledge. Thematic evolution further indicates a shift from foundational concerns related to firm performance, manufacturing, and strategy towards more recent interests in business models, eco-innovation, digitalization, and empirical contextualization.

Mapping the research landscape of SME success factors: a configurational perspective based on bibliometric evidence

Small and medium-sized enterprises (SMEs) play a central role in employment generation, innovation diffusion, local economic dynamism, and sustainable development. However, research on SME success remains fragmented, often emphasizing isolated determinants rather than integrated explanations. This study maps the scientific landscape of SME success factors from a configurational perspective, considering how strategic orientations, organizational capabilities, implementation practices, and contextual conditions interact to shape business performance. A bibliometric and science mapping study was conducted using records retrieved from Scopus and Web of Science. The search covered publications indexed between 1985 and 2025 and was conducted on February 4, 2025. After duplicate removal, title and abstract screening, and full-text assessment following PRISMA 2020 guidelines, 935 studies were included in the final corpus. Data were processed and analyzed using R and VOSviewer. The analysis included publication trends, citation patterns, productive journals, highly cited documents, keyword co-occurrence, co-authorship networks, co-citation structures, and bibliographic coupling. The findings show a progressive consolidation of SME success research, with accelerated growth from 2016 onward. The most influential research streams are centered on entrepreneurial orientation, critical success factors, operational excellence, innovation, digital transformation, sustainability, green innovation, and circular economy practices. The intellectual structure of the field is supported by strategic management, entrepreneurship, innovation, and sustainability literatures. International collaboration patterns reveal an expanding but unevenly distributed research network, with several countries acting as central knowledge hubs. The evidence suggests that SME success cannot be adequately explained through single-factor or linear approaches. Instead, it should be understood as a multidimensional and contingent phenomenon shaped by configurations of internal capabilities, strategic choices, implementation processes, and external environmental conditions. This study provides an integrated map of the field and offers a foundation for future theoretical development, comparative empirical research, and policy design aimed at strengthening competitive and sustainable SME performance.

Mapping the research landscape of digital transformation, ESG, and environmental uncertainty: a bibliometric analysis of corporate development research

This study presents a bibliometric analysis of research on digital transformation, ESG performance, environmental uncertainty, and corporate development using a dataset of 288 Scopus-indexed articles and review papers published between 2015 and 2025. Employing bibliometric and science-mapping techniques, the study examines publication trends, thematic evolution, conceptual structures, and emerging research trajectories within the field. The findings reveal a sharp increase in scientific production after 2021, reflecting a broader transition from technology-centered perspectives toward sustainability-oriented and resilience-based approaches. The results indicate that digital transformation and sustainability have become dominant conceptual anchors, whereas governance-oriented ESG mechanisms and uncertainty-aware decision frameworks remain comparatively fragmented and weakly interconnected. This imbalance suggests that existing studies have not yet fully integrated digital capabilities, sustainability governance, resilience, and environmental uncertainty into a coherent framework. By identifying dominant intellectual patterns and persistent conceptual gaps, this study contributes to a more integrated understanding of how digital transformation and ESG-related pressures shape sustainable corporate development under uncertain environmental conditions.
